New thread for this game, but is necessary, because i have a lot of information to tell to all interested in this.
I started with the UNDUB project, because this game was ugly dubbed, in special, the opening theme.
I manage to fix that, but others problems starting to show. Now i manage to fix nearly all problems:
a) UNDUB is nearly finished:
- Japanese voices (when the character or your partner attacks).
- Press Start Screen: In the previous version, this screen didn't have sound, NOW have the original JP music.
- Opening Theme: In japanese, WITH the US video (you only notice the difference when you see the video and show the part of the logo of Phantasy Star Zero with japanese characters under the logo). b) Japanese Items:
- I manage to find the way to have the JP items in the US version. Is a texture file that I reinserted and magic! JP items without problems. c) What we need to finish 100%:
- JP Items didn't have the special sound like the original (at least Mario's Warp Pipe Bazooka sounds like a generic Bazooka).
- JP Items have the same name as a generic weapon. For example, Hylia Shield is called Shield, but IS Hylia Shield.
- Able to edit the .mods files (video scenes) and undub it.
* PATCH:PS0_UNDUB_V2 | MIRROR - YOU NEED TO USE THIS VERSION OF PS0: Phantasy_Star_Zero_USA_PROPER_NDS-BAHAMUT without trim (128 mb).
Note: After patching the game, you can trim it!

* More Technical Information:
If you want to know what files was modified, this are some:
a) sound/sound_data_bgm.sdat:
- This file have all music files.
- US version have a extra file, and that's the reason that my first undub doesn't have music in the press start screen. (Now is Fixed!)
- I replaced some internal files in the .sdat file, like SEQ_BGM_TITLE.sseq with a copy version of SEQ_BGM_MAIN.sseq (original used by JP version).
- In .sdat, i reinserted 083-STRM_OPENING.STRM with the JP version, making posible the JP Opening Theme.
b) sound_data_se.sdat -> Character voices, a simple replaced action to have JP voices.
c) items/weapons.zarc -> Items textures. (Now has the JP items!)
